Job Description

As a Financial Operations Administrator at Corcentric, you will join a fun, collaborative team within an ambitious, entrepreneurial global organization. Working with the Financial Operations team, you will support billing system data processing and reporting, as well as assist internal and external customers with billing issues and questions. You will be responsible for collaborating on various operations and accounting projects, including partnering with cross-functional teams to drive improvements to business processes.


This key position reports to the Sr. Director, Financial Operations within our Financial Operations team. We're a dedicated, down-to-earth group in a growing organization offering plenty of opportunity. We look forward to adding you into the mix!



As a Financial Operations Administrator, you'll be responsible for:


  • Support Financial Operation Leads with overflow or workload or assigned processes
  • Utilize Microsoft Great Plains, Excel, Access, PowerPoint and browser applications
  • Monitor the various department generic email boxes and respond to inquiries and requests within 24 hours
  • Process billing for Corcentric generated processes either via Azure importing tool directly into D365 (COR360, PO Solutions, GPO PFAC-Canada, etc.) or using Excel templates to import into our customer facing CorConnect portals (Meetings, NTLA various dues, Supply Management annual fees, Logistics consulting, etc.)
  • Run queries from accounting system and/or web portals to analyze data, report trends, variances, and reconcile portal with General Ledger Account(s)
  • Create customer profiles for systems that do not auto-create from other systems (i.e. PO Solution customers, GPO-Vendor customers, COR360 customers, etc.)
  • Analyze monthly billing data and provide trend analysis
  • Create written procedures for new processes assigned and review existing procedures for gaps and update as necessary
  • Process quarterly BOD payments
  • Working knowledge and ability to process manual entry of AP, AR, JE in D365
  • Attend and sometimes lead recurring or impromptu meetings
Requirements

You'll need to have:


  • Excellent interpersonal skills with a customer service focus
  • A learning-mindset, with a solid sense of ownership and accountability in taking on projects and work commitments
  • Excellent MS Excel skills, including the ability to use pivot tables, VLOOKUPs, and common functions such as sorting, filters, subtotals, etc.)
  • Familiarity with MS Access and Adobe Suite
  • Ability to multitask and work in a fast-paced environment
  • Bachelor's degree in accounting, finance, or business; or equivalent work experience
  • Ability to function as a team player and maintain good working relationships with other departments
  • Ability to analyze a large volume of transactions efficiently and accurately
